#ifndef LIST_H_H
|
|
#define LIST_H_H
|
|
|
|
#include <stdio.h>
|
|
#include <malloc.h>
|
|
#include <string.h>
|
|
|
|
typedef struct clist *List;
|
|
|
|
typedef int (*compare)(void *ndata, void *data);
|
|
typedef void (*dofunc)(void *ndata);
|
|
|
|
typedef int (*lpf0)(List l, void *data);
|
|
typedef int (*lpf1)(List l, void *data, compare pfunc);
|
|
typedef List (*lpf2)(List l);
|
|
typedef void (*lpf3)(List l);
|
|
typedef void (*lpf4)(List l, dofunc pfunc);
|
|
typedef int (*lpf5)(List l, unsigned int index, void *new_data);
|
|
typedef void (*lpf6)(List l, compare pfunc);
|
|
typedef int (*lpf7)(List l, unsigned int index);
|
|
|
|
typedef struct cnode
|
|
{
|
|
void *data;
|
|
struct cnode *next;
|
|
}node, *Node;
|
|
|
|
typedef struct clist
|
|
{
|
|
Node head;
|
|
Node tail;
|
|
unsigned int size;
|
|
unsigned int data_size;
|
|
lpf0 add_back;
|
|
lpf0 add_front;
|
|
lpf1 delete_node;
|
|
lpf1 have_same;
|
|
lpf0 have_same_cmp;
|
|
lpf4 foreach;
|
|
lpf3 clear;
|
|
lpf2 destroy;
|
|
lpf5 modify_at;
|
|
lpf6 sort;
|
|
lpf7 delete_at;
|
|
}list;
|
|
|
|
//初始化链表
|
|
List list_init(unsigned int data_size);
|
|
int list_add_back(List l, void *data);
|
|
int list_add_front(List l, void *data);
|
|
int list_delete_node(List l, void *data, compare pfunc);
|
|
int list_delete_at(List l, unsigned int index);
|
|
int list_modify_at(List l, unsigned int index, void *new_data);
|
|
int list_have_same(List l, void *data, compare pfunc);
|
|
int list_have_same_cmp(List l, void *data);
|
|
void list_foreach(List l, dofunc doit);
|
|
void list_sort(List l, compare pfunc);
|
|
void list_clear(List l);
|
|
//释放链表
|
|
List list_destroy(List l);
|
|
#endif
